// SECURITY REVIEW NOTE: This constant caps retry attempts for the new
// Quenby-based dispatcher that replaces our homegrown job queue. The old
// queue allowed unbounded requeues, which enabled the amplification issue
// flagged last audit. Value chosen to match the threat model in the
// Larkfell design doc. The reviewed build is identified by the token
// appended on the following line.

pipeline stamp: htk4_ae36

**Ticket: Drift in Bellhop deploy-bot config**

Heads up for folks new to the team: Bellhop (our deploy-status chat bot) has drifted from what's in version control. Someone hot-patched the channel routing and polling interval directly on the host, so the repo no longer reflects reality. Until we re-sync, don't trust the checked-in file. To save you an SSH trip, here's what's actually running on the box right now.

deployment values, yadug-bawif:
[framir]
team = pelox
access_code = ac_a38ab2
owner = tamion.julael
host = framir.tolvaqlabs.test
port = 11211
peer = tammir.zemvargrid.local
salt = 2215ef03
pin = 1541

We're seeing cold-start latency on the Lumewick checkout handlers climb from ~400ms to over 2s in the staging account. Root cause is configuration drift: provisioned concurrency and memory settings were changed manually in staging three weeks ago and never reconciled with the declared state in the deploy repo. Prod still matches the repo, so the release candidate was validated against settings that no longer reflect staging. Before the next release cut, staging must be restored to the declared baseline, reproduced here for reference.

settings of yahaf-tahop:
jorox:
  pin: 5851
  tenant: noveth
  seal: seal_7ddb5c42
  metrics_host: metrics.jorox.ordinnet.example
  standby_team: wenax
  escalation: oliath-feneth
  nonce: 552548

**Action item 4 (owner: platform team, due next sprint).** During the Brindlemoor outage, support couldn't tell which color of the billing worker was live, so customers got conflicting answers about invoice delays. We're adding a status banner that shows the active pool and deploy phase in plain language—no dashboard spelunking needed. Until that ships, support can check deploy state manually; the walkthrough for doing that lives here.

wiki page, kageg-fawip: https://jira.tolvaqsys.internal/projects/pages/pages/a21b2f71